Sarah Quist, a seasoned performer, honed her skills singing with legends in London’s iconic venues, captivating global audiences with her versatile voice in Jazz, Blues, and Soul.
Beyond music, Sarah contributed to albums and collaborated with soul legend Willie Mitchell in Memphis. As a band leader, she led groups like ‘Indian Spring’ and ‘The Sarah Quist Quartet,’ showcasing both covers and originals.
Trained at RADA, Sarah’s acting career includes collaborations with esteemed companies and actors like Vanessa Redgrave and Alan Cumming. Notably, she recently starred in “King Lear” and is currently in Tom Stoppard’s “Travesties.” She’s also recognized for roles in “The Man Who Fell to Earth,” “Eastenders,” “The Sandman,” “Doctors,” and various other well known TV shows and broadcasts.
In addition to her roles as a singer/songwriter and actress, Sarah is a Co-Founder of Creative Awakenings, using the arts to boost confidence, communication, and social skills in schools and communities.
Sarah will guide workshop participants to master their skills and reach maximum potential with full confidence and delivery.
